Foldable Solar Panels Market Outlook
The global foldable solar panels market is projected to reach a value of approximately USD 2.5 billion by 2035, growing at a CAGR of 15.2% during the forecast period of 2025 to 2035. The increasing demand for renewable energy solutions, coupled with the rising need for portable and efficient energy sources, has accelerated the adoption of foldable solar panels. Additionally, advancements in solar technology and materials have significantly enhanced the efficiency and performance of these panels, making them an attractive option for various applications. Moreover, the growing trend of sustainability and energy independence among consumers further fuels the market growth, as foldable solar panels provide a versatile solution for energy generation in remote and off-grid locations. With the increasing prevalence of outdoor recreational activities, portable foldable solar panels have become essential for camping, hiking, and other outdoor events, driving demand in this segment.

By Product Type
Monocrystalline Foldable Solar Panels:
Monocrystalline foldable solar panels are known for their high efficiency and space-saving design, making them a popular choice among consumers. These panels are constructed from a single crystal structure, which allows for better electron movement and increased power output. As a result, they often require less space compared to other types of solar panels, which is crucial for portable applications. The lightweight and flexible nature of monocrystalline panels makes them ideal for outdoor activities such as camping and hiking, where portability is essential. Furthermore, advancements in technology continue to improve their efficiency, attracting environmentally conscious consumers who prioritize performance and sustainability.
Polycrystalline Foldable Solar Panels:
Polycrystalline foldable solar panels are an alternative option that provides a more cost-effective solution while still offering decent efficiency levels. These panels are made from multiple crystal structures, which may result in lower efficiency compared to monocrystalline options, but they are usually less expensive to produce. This affordability makes polycrystalline panels appealing for larger-scale applications where cost is a significant concern. The durability of these panels allows them to withstand various weather conditions, making them suitable for both residential and commercial uses. As demand for more economical solar solutions continues to rise, the polycrystalline segment of the foldable solar panel market is expected to expand accordingly.
Thin-Film Foldable Solar Panels:
Thin-film foldable solar panels are characterized by their lightweight and flexible design, making them highly portable and versatile for a range of applications. Unlike traditional solar panels, which are rigid and bulky, thin-film technology allows for greater flexibility in installation and deployment. These panels can be integrated into various surfaces, such as backpacks, clothing, and tents, providing an innovative solution for outdoor enthusiasts and emergency response teams. While they typically have lower efficiency rates compared to crystalline panels, advancements in thin-film technology have led to improvements in performance, making them an attractive option for those requiring adaptable and lightweight energy solutions.

By Region
The North American foldable solar panels market is anticipated to witness substantial growth, driven by increasing awareness of renewable energy and sustainability initiatives. The region's market is projected to reach approximately USD 800 million by 2035, growing at a CAGR of 14.8% during the forecast period. The presence of numerous outdoor recreational activities, combined with a growing emphasis on energy independence, fuels the demand for portable solar energy solutions. Additionally, government incentives promoting renewable energy adoption and technological advancements in solar technology will further enhance the market outlook in North America.
In Europe, the foldable solar panels market is also experiencing significant growth, with a projected market size of around USD 600 million by 2035. The European market is characterized by strong consumer interest in environmental sustainability and energy efficiency, driving the adoption of renewable energy solutions across various sectors. The region's commitment to reducing greenhouse gas emissions and transitioning to clean energy sources supports the growth of foldable solar panels in residential, commercial, and industrial applications. As technological advancements continue to improve the efficiency and performance of these panels, Europe is set to become a key player in the global foldable solar panel market.

Threats
Despite the promising outlook for the foldable solar panels market, several threats could impact its growth trajectory. One significant threat comes from the volatility of raw material prices, which can affect the cost of production for solar panels. Fluctuations in materials such as silicon, metals, and plastics may lead to increased production costs, ultimately impacting retail prices and consumer demand. As manufacturers seek to maintain competitive pricing while ensuring profitability, navigating these fluctuations will be crucial for long-term sustainability in the market. Additionally, the emergence of alternative energy solutions may pose a challenge, as consumers explore various options for renewable energy generation, which could divert interest away from foldable solar panels.
Another critical challenge is the competitive landscape of the foldable solar panel market. With the increasing demand for renewable energy solutions, a growing number of companies are entering the space, resulting in heightened competition. As new entrants develop innovative products and technologies, existing manufacturers must continuously adapt and differentiate themselves to maintain market share. This competition may lead to price wars, diminishing profit margins, and increased pressure to innovate. To navigate this challenge, companies must focus on establishing strong brand identities, leveraging cutting-edge technology, and delivering exceptional customer service to foster consumer loyalty.
